Babu, Pawan Non Resident Politicos, Says Jagan

Terming Chandrababu Naidu and Pawan Kalyan as non-resident politicians, Chief Minister YS Jagan Mohan Reddy said they know nothing about social justice.

The two of them do not reside in our state, and if someone wants to see them, a trip to the neighboring state is necessary, which shows how distant they are from the people.

Chandrababu ran away from Chandragiri to Kuppam, and his foster son Pawan Kalyan keeps visiting Andhra during his leisure and travels from other states.

Pawan Kalyan, who supported the TDP’s policy of plunder, stash, and devour, has once again joined hands with the TDP, and they are trying to cheat the people with false promises ahead of elections, hoping that people’s memory is short, he said.

The pack of wolves has come together and is spreading falsehood with the support of friendly media, he said, and appealed to the people not to be misled.

“I don’t have friendly media or alliances. I depend on you and God,” he told them during the foundation stone-laying function of Chittoor Dairy on Tuesday.

Appealing to the people to think about why the TDP failed to implement welfare schemes while the present government spent Rs. 2.23 lakh crores through DBT welfare schemes in the last four years, the Chief Minister called upon them to support the YSRCP in the next elections if they feel they have benefitted from the welfare schemes.
